Biography

Saleh Adnan is an Adjunct Fellow at Macquarie University with a specialization in Agricultural Entomology. He completed his PhD focused on the Sterile Insect Technique for the Queensland fruit fly, Bactrocera tryoni, from 2016 to 2020. His research interests include insect olfaction, gas chromatography, and chemical ecology, with an emphasis on understanding the interactions between insects and their environment. Over the years, Saleh has led several research projects and collaborated with a diverse group of researchers in his field. He maintains an active presence in the academic community with a significant h-index and numerous publications.
